The Role of Databases in Java: An In-Depth Analysis**

In the realm of software development, databases play a pivotal role, and when it comes to Java, their significance is even more pronounced. Java, being a versatile programming language, seamlessly integrates with various databases, allowing developers to build robust and scalable applications. This article delves into the multifaceted roles that databases serve in the context of Java, shedding light on how they enhance the functionality and efficiency of Java-based applications.

At its core, a database serves as a repository for storing, retrieving, and managing data. In Java, this translates to the ability to efficiently handle large volumes of data, ensuring quick access and modification without compromising performance. The use of relational databases like MySQL, PostgreSQL, or Oracle enables Java applications to maintain structured data, facilitating complex queries and operations.

One of the key aspects of databases in Java is their role in data persistence. By enabling developers to save application state and user-generated content persistently, databases ensure that data is not lost even when the application is restarted or in case of system failures. This is crucial for maintaining the integrity and consistency of data across sessions.

Furthermore, databases facilitate data sharing and collaboration among different components of an application. In a Java web application, for instance, databases enable the storage and retrieval of user information, session data, and application settings across multiple users and devices. This shared access to data promotes a cohesive user experience and streamlines workflow processes.

Another significant role of databases in Java is their contribution to security and privacy. Through features such as encryption, authentication, and authorization, databases help protect sensitive data from unauthorized access. This is particularly important in applications dealing with personal information or financial transactions, where data security is paramount.

Moreover, databases in Java support advanced analytical capabilities. With the integration of tools like Apache Spark or Hadoop, Java applications can process and analyze large datasets, uncovering insights and generating actionable intelligence. This capability is invaluable for businesses seeking to make data-driven decisions and optimize their operations.

Additionally, the use of NoSQL databases has expanded the horizons of Java applications. These databases, which do not adhere to the traditional relational model, offer flexibility and scalability, making them ideal for handling unstructured or semi-structured data. Technologies like MongoDB or Cassandra allow Java developers to design highly performant and dynamic applications that can adapt to changing requirements.
